The SEBER RU2000CP Ratcheting Satin Utility Knife combines a precision ratcheting blade mechanism with a robust stainless steel and alloy steel construction. Featuring a G10 handle for enhanced grip and a locking blade for safety, this lightweight, foldable tool is engineered for professionals who demand durability, control, and portability in one sleek package.

Solid knife but needs refined.
Spring that holds blade release popped out, so I removed it completely. Isn't real comfortable to hold. Pocket clip is large and easily catches on stuff it isn't supposed to.You have to move the button to open the knife, then move it the other way to close it, kind of a pain, would be better to just have a spring loaded button that would allow you to move knife to where you want it and lock it there.Locking at small angles is nice for cutting plastic pipe and stripping insulation off of large electrical cables.

Very good utility knife -- handles all the basics you want including unique adjustable locking angle feature
Very good utility blade knife.Pros:Durable stainless steel.Blade removal w/o toolsAdjustable locking angle for bladeCons:Heavy.Poor styling -- something a Russian would designFair ergonomics for hand-holding -- wished it had finger guard like Gerber EAB Lite.2-handed operationAlternatives:Milwaukee Fastback 3 -- I give it 5 stars.Better: aluminum handle - lighter.Wider - easier to hold.Features - built-in wire cutter and extra blade storage, 2 locking positions.Easier - opens and closes with one hand with flipping motion.
